Transaction 6525746a3fc080ce380e26227a43dc5dc36a3f843cba1f5950b3b303aeb04e86
1 Input
2 Outputs
- 6525746a3fc080ce380e26227a43dc5dc36a3f843cba1f5950b3b303aeb04e86:0
- 6525746a3fc080ce380e26227a43dc5dc36a3f843cba1f5950b3b303aeb04e86:1
value 5689243
address 1JwsVCFXJWshRGQbswRenzZsmo7LwZhNkB
value 16967478
address 3E7JvEDSRrir7msYby9XHZdJwpAR2N2sYX